The Russett Learning Trust and Trustees wish to appoint suitably qualified Grade 4 Teaching Assistants to join our hard working and enthusiastic team at the Russett School.

Our Values are the foundation from which we grow and develop.

We value. **Community - Resilience - Wellbeing - Respect

  • Empowerment**At the Russett School we seek to prepare our learners for life through prioritising skills required to meet their full potential.


Through our specialist curriculum, our children and young people are empowered through a strong emphasis on the development of individual communication strategies.


Our Russett team provide enriching and safe environments, where our pupils are encouraged to develop independence, whilst promoting well-being for a happy and fulfilled future.

We have also asked our pupils what they would like to see in a Teaching Assistant and these are some of their responses:
Sporty, respectful, helpful, talented, proactive, smart and intelligent, someone nice and quiet, good at science, maths, building and running and someone who does fun stuff and makes cakes


This is an outstanding opportunity for Teaching Assistants who are suitably qualified and experienced with passion and drive to make a difference for pupils and young people with SEN.

We value our team and the Trust is committed to supporting and developing staff through a comprehensive staff training programme, extensive CPD and ongoing career development opportunities.

The post is ex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 and the school is therefore permitted to ask job applicants to declare all convictions and cautions (including those which are 'spent' unless 'protected' under the DBS filtering rules) in order to assess their suitability to work with children.
